Requirements for a Work Permit in Turkey

To be eligible for a self-employed work permit in Turkey, applicants must meet the following requirements:
Business Plan: Applicants must submit a comprehensive business plan that outlines their business objectives, target market, marketing strategies, and financial projections.
Educational Qualifications: Applicants must have the necessary educational qualifications or work experience in their chosen field.
Financial Resources: Applicants must have sufficient financial resources to support their business operations in Turkey.
Health Insurance: Applicants must have valid health insurance coverage in Turkey.
Criminal Record: Applicants must have a clean criminal record in their country of origin and in Turkey.

Application Process for a Self-Employed Work Permit in Turkey

The application process for a self-employed work permit in Turkey is as follows:

Apply Online: Applicants must apply online through the Turkish Ministry of Interior’s online system. The application must be completed in Turkish and all documents must be uploaded in digital format.
Submission of Required Documents: Applicants must submit the following documents:
Passport or travel document
Four passport-sized photographs
Business plan
Evidence of financial resources
Educational qualifications or work experience certificates
Criminal record certificate
Payment of Fees: Applicants must pay the relevant fees online.
Review and Decision: The application will be reviewed by the Ministry of Interior and the Provincial Directorate of Migration Management. If the application is approved, the applicant will receive a residence permit, which is valid for up to two years.
